Harmony on the Green Launches 4th Season in Lexington with Two Local Artists

The Harmony on the Green Coffeehouse Concerts at Hancock Church is pleased to announce the launch of its fall season on Saturday, September 27th at 7:30 p.m. with a concert featuring two amazing local artists–Nicolas Emden and Jerry Martinez.

“This is a special show” says series director, Mark Morgan, “both Nicolas and Jerry appeared with us as opening acts, and we were so impressed by their talent that we decided we wanted them back as headliners.” Nicolas Emden is a talented multi-instrumentalist, composer, singer, and songwriter, hailing from Chilean Patagonia. His music navigates the waters of pop, rock, and South American folk, creating a distinctive South Americana indie folk rock sound, with evocative Spanish lyrics. He will be appearing with his duo for this show. Jerry Martinez has been active in the local (and not so local) music scene for over 4 decades. He is a songwriter, guitarist, and singer steeped in the Americana, Singer/Songwriter, Blues, and Folk traditions. Over the years he has developed a unique synthesis of these art-forms and blended them into a powerful writing style that aims for the heart. Jerry’s vocals, described as “soulful and powerful”, drive home the often poignant messages in his songs. “Jerry did some of the most amazing guitar playing I’d heard in a long time,” says Morgan, ‘its definitely not something to be missed!”

The show takes place at Clark Hall at Hancock Church, 1912 Massachusetts Ave in Lexington. Tickets are $25 or “pay what you can” and are available at harmonyonthegreen.org. Free parking is available in the rear of the church. The church is handicap accessible, and assisted listening devices are available. Free beverages and homebaked baked goods will be served.
